The Worker-to-Beneficiary Ratio

(Congressional Budget Office)

The self-funding nature of Social Security payroll taxes is under pressure because the ratio of workers paying into the system versus those receiving benefits is falling. This worker-to-beneficiary ratio was 4.9 in 1960, 2.8 in 2010, and is projected to be 1.9 in 2035.
